
使用Go语言开发实时数据处理系统的方法与技巧
随着信息时代的到来,实时数据处理成为了众多企业和组织中的一项重要任务。在这个快节奏、大数据的时代,如何高效、准确地处理海量的数据成为了一项关键技术。而Go语言作为一门高效、并发处理能力强大的编程语言,被越来越多的开发者选择来构建实时数据处理系统。
本文主要介绍使用Go语言开发实时数据处理系统的一些方法与技巧,希望可以为开发者们提供一些有用的指导。
首先,我们需要明确实时数据处理系统的定义。实时数据处理系统指的是能够在数据到达时立即进行处理的系统,以便实时获得结果或作出相应的动作。这种系统需要具备高性能、低延迟、高并发的特点。
立即学习“go语言免费学习笔记(深入)”;
接下来,我们将介绍一些开发实时数据处理系统的方法和技巧:
除了上述方法和技巧外,还有一些其他的建议:
总结起来,使用Go语言开发实时数据处理系统需要注意并发编程、异步IO操作、高效的数据结构、内存管理和性能优化等方面。同时,合理地划分模块和功能,使用合适的库和框架,并添加适当的异常处理和容错机制也是非常重要的。
通过充分利用Go语言的特性和优势,开发者可以构建出高性能、高并发的实时数据处理系统,为企业和组织提供卓越的服务。希望本文对使用Go语言开发实时数据处理系统的开发者们有所帮助。
以上就是使用Go语言开发实时数据处理系统的方法与技巧的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号